About the Item

Rare multi gemstones necklace designed by Seaman Schepps. Colorful vintage piece, created in New York city at the atelier of Seaman Schepps, back in the early 1970's. This beautiful one-of-a-kind necklace has been crafted with free forms patterns in solid yellow gold of 14 karats. It is suited with a push mechanical lock and is embellished with a great colorful selection of natural gemstones, described as follow; In four-prongs settings, with 8 oval cabochon cut (16 x 11 x 8 mm) of red rubies, 122.48 carats. In a bezel setting, with 1 oval cabochon cut (23 x 16 x 10 mm) of red ruby, 39.74carats. In four-prongs settings, with 7 freeform cabochon cut of Brazilian Aquamarines, 210 carats. In four-prongs settings, with 29 round cabochon cut (4-4.5 mm) of Burmese vivid red rubies, 12.15 carats. Has a total weight of 128.9 grams and a lenght of 15 Inches (38 Cm). Stamped, with the company maker's mark, the serial number, the gold assay hallmarks and signed, "SEAMAN SCHEPPS C PSV OF 14KT". Seaman Schepps was an American jeweler famous for his retro style, 1950's jewelry design. The company was established in the 1905 as an antique and retailer store. in the 1931 was founded officially as a jewelry designer in New York and the workshop store was located at 516 in Madison Avenue. in the 1933 the business was so successful that they moved to a larger showroom at the 399 in the same avenue. The firm was sold in the 1992. Note: Aquamarine gemstones are the birthstone of March. In ancient period, the Greeks and Romans thought of aquamarine as the sailor’s gem. They believed the blue gem would protect the travelers during storms while traveling across the seas. Ancient cultures also thought aquamarine was a token of love between dating and married couples. Now, it’s the official gemstone to celebrate a 19th marriage anniversary. It is in perfect condition with gorgeous bold look. INVENTORY REF: N0000ANNNM/3.098

Revival jewelry The styles from the renaissance and Middle Ages, begun in the 1850’s, The Renaissance and Egyptian revivals were joined by a classical revival of Greek and Etruscan styles to conform a new aesthetic. As a result of the construction work on the Suez Canal in the mid-1860’s and the Egyptian excavations of Auguste Mariette and the resultant exhibit of Egyptian treasures at the exposition Universelle in 1867, a fascination for all things Egyptian and ancient cultures developed. For centuries, Ancient Egypt and the Etruscans has held the fascination of the public and continues to inspire artists and designers alike. Between the 1860 and 1890, ancient cities were discovered, such as Troy, Pompeii and Alexandria. Archaeological excavations in Egypt, Greece and Rome, discovered artistic pieces of these ancient cultures. These fabulous discoveries, stimulated cultural trips to these countries, popularly called "grand tour". Being the case that the enthusiast visitors bring back small objects, like souvenirs to be assembled into jewelry. The starting point of these trips were in the cities of Rome and Venice. this is why the craftsmen of these cities created small and interesting objects with ancient characteristics like this suite. In addition, during the half of the nineteenth-century, the publication of Darwin’s Origin of Species coupled with massive urbanization resulted in a popular fascination with the natural world. One of the more weird and wonderful ways this fascination manifested was as a fad for jewelry created from the iridescent green shells of scarab beetles. The little jewel-toned bugs were incorporated into everything from hatpins to bracelets, earrings and necklaces. In 1884 the Countess Granville even had an entire suite crafted of beetles. Festoon Necklace A festoon necklace, is a design motif of a garland or string of flowers, leaves or ribbons. A festoon is a type of necklace that contains several drapes or swags of beads, chains, metal extensions, or other parts as the core elements of the design. Was very popular in the 18th and 19th century and even today. Country: Europe, England. Period: Victorian, Etruscan revival, 1880-1890.
